YL08 PGF is a 2008 Renault Scenic in Beige with a 1,461c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.
Across all 2008 Renault Scenic models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.9% with a typical mileage of 62,591 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ault Scenic f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 108,325 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YL08 PGF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Scenic typ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 18 years old, this Renault Scenic is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
